BAVARIAN SAUERKRAUT
This recipe has to be the best tasting sauerkraut I've ever had. Traditionally, my family serves pork and sauerkraut every New Year's Day for luck in the coming year. Steps:
- Heat bacon drippings in a large skillet over medium heat; cook and stir onion until soft and translucent, about 5 minutes.
- Place sauerkraut with juice into a large bowl and cover with water. Stir and use your hands to squeeze out as much of the water and juice as possible. Add squeezed sauerkraut to onion.
- Stir brown sugar, caraway seeds, chicken stock, and cooking sherry into the sauerkraut mixture. Reduce heat to low and simmer until almost all the liquid has evaporated, 30 to 40 minutes, stirring occasionally.

SAUERKRAUT FROM THE NASCHMARKT
Vienna is home to the Naschmarkt, a famous open air market featuring...everything. There is one stand known to anyone who has ever been to the Naschmarkt for its Sauerkraut. If the owner likes you he'll take you aside & ask you how you intend to prepare it & then proceed to tell you the "proper way". Steps:
- Saute onion in oil.
- Then add sauerkraut, Carroway seeds, Juniper berries, bay leaf.
- Add enough soup so that there is enough liquid to let this cook for 30 minutes.
- After 20 minutes add the raw shredded potatoe& let cook the last 10 minute.
- Right before the end you can add the wine& let it cook for a minute or 2.

EASY HOMEMADE SAUERKRAUT
Sauerkraut has been a staple for hundreds of years. This is great on its own or as a topper for a variety of foods. Refrigerate or freeze sauerkraut once it is fermented.

Steps:
- Mix cabbage, onion, sea salt, and garlic together in a bowl. Firmly pack mixture into a large, clean, food-grade plastic bucket. The cabbage will start to make its own brine as the salt starts to draw out the water of the cabbage.
- Fill a large, clean, food-grade plastic bag with water and place over the salted cabbage mixture so none of the cabbage is exposed to air.
- Allow cabbage to ferment in a cool, dry place, 1 to 4 weeks (depending on how tangy you like your sauerkraut). The temperature of the room you ferment the sauerkraut in should not rise above 70 degrees F (21 degrees C).
